Baka is a platelet alloantigen whose putative allele, Bakb, has not been identified previously. By using a serum, "Har," obtained from a patient with posttransfusion purpura, we describe the platelet alloantigen Bakb. The Har serum reacted with an NP-40-extractable platelet membrane protein of 142 kd with mobility similar to platelet glycoprotein IIb alpha. We found that the antigen recognized by the Har serum is inherited in an autosomal dominant mode with an apparent gene frequency of .39. Chi-square analysis of observed and expected phenotype frequencies indicated that serum Har recognizes Bakb, the anticipated allele of Baka. Our findings provide new evidence for polymorphism of glycoprotein IIb and for the association of posttransfusion purpura with alloimmunization to determinants on this glycoprotein. 相似文献

Lethal midline granuloma (LMG) is associated with Epstein-Barr virus (EBV). The latter has at least two subtypes with different biological properties. The subtypes can be identified by their genomic configuration. Using EBV-RNA (EBER) in situ hybridization and EBV polymerase chain reaction (PCR), we have looked for the presence of EBV in six LMGs and six non-Hodgkin's lymphomas (NHLs) located in the nasopharyngeal region, and determined the subtype of EBV. Six of six LMGs were positive by PCR and EBER in situ hybridization, whereas NHLs were either negative or, in three of six cases, showed few EBER- positive cells considered to be nonneoplastic lymphocytes. The subtype 2 was found in LMG lesions of three of six patients; the remaining three of six patients with LMG had the generally occurring subtype 1. The results indicate that the association of EBV with NHL may depend more on tumor type than on its localization. The occurrence of the rare subtype 2 in LMG may relate to a covert immune defect. 相似文献

Enzymatic reduction of disulfide bonds in lysosomes: characterization of a gamma-interferon-inducible lysosomal thiol reductase (GILT) 总被引:4,自引:0,他引:4 下载免费PDF全文
Arunachalam B Phan UT Geuze HJ Cresswell P 《Proceedings of the National Academy of Sciences of the United States of America》2000,97(2):745-750
Proteins internalized into the endocytic pathway are usually degraded. Efficient proteolysis requires denaturation, induced by acidic conditions within lysosomes, and reduction of inter- and intrachain disulfide bonds. Cytosolic reduction is mediated enzymatically by thioredoxin, but the mechanism of lysosomal reduction is unknown. We describe here a lysosomal thiol reductase optimally active at low pH and capable of catalyzing disulfide bond reduction both in vivo and in vitro. The active site, determined by mutagenesis, consists of a pair of cysteine residues separated by two amino acids, similar to other enzymes of the thioredoxin family. The enzyme is a soluble glycoprotein that is synthesized as a precursor. After delivery into the endosomal/lysosomal system by the mannose 6-phosphate receptor, N- and C-terminal prosequences are removed. The enzyme is expressed constitutively in antigen-presenting cells and induced by IFN-gamma in other cell types, suggesting a potentially important role in antigen processing. 相似文献

The clinical history and histological features of seven cases of granulomatous mastitis are presented. The lesion occurs in young parous women as a tender extra-areolar breast lump. Histologically, non-caseating discrete granulomas are present, confined to breast lobules with, in three cases, coalescence of the granulomas and microabscess formation. Pathogenesis of the changes is discussed. It is thought that granulomatous mastitis is an entity morphologically distinct from duct ectasia/plasma cell mastitis and the commoner forms of granulomatous breast diseases. 相似文献

Erythropoietin structure-function relationships: high degree of sequence homology among mammals 总被引:7,自引:3,他引:4
Wen D; Boissel JP; Tracy TE; Gruninger RH; Mulcahy LS; Czelusniak J; Goodman M; Bunn HF 《Blood》1993,82(5):1507-1516
To investigate structure-function relationships of erythropoietin (Epo), we have obtained cDNA sequences that encode the mature Epo protein of a variety of mammals. A first set of primers, corresponding to conserved nucleotide sequences between mouse and human DNAs, allowed us to amplify by polymerase chain reaction (PCR) intron 1/exon 2 fragments from genomic DNA of the hamster, cat, lion, dog, horse, sheep, dolphin, and pig. Sequencing of these fragments permitted the design of a second generation of species-specific primers. RNA was prepared from anemic kidneys and reverse-transcribed. Using our battery of species-specific 5' primers, we were able to successfully PCR- amplify Epo cDNA from Rhesus monkey, rat, sheep, dog, cat, and pig. Deduced amino acid sequences of mature Epo proteins from these animals, in combination with known sequences for human, Cynomolgus monkey, and mouse, showed a high degree of homology, which explains the biologic and immunological cross-reactivity that has been observed in a number of species. Human Epo is 91% identical to monkey Epo, 85% to cat and dog Epo, and 80% to 82% to pig, sheep, mouse, and rat Epos. There was full conservation of (1) the disulfide bridge linking the NH2 and COOH termini; (2) N-glycosylation sites; and (3) predicted amphipathic alpha- helices. In contrast, the short disulfide bridge (C29/C33 in humans) is not invariant. Cys33 was replaced by a Pro in rodents. Most of the amino acid replacements were conservative. The C-terminal part of the loop between the C and D helices showed the most variation, with several amino acid substitutions, deletions, and/or insertions. Calculations of maximum parsimony for intron 1/exon 2 sequences as well as coding sequences enabled the construction of cladograms that are in good agreement with known phylogenetic relationships. 相似文献

Immunoelectron microscopic localization of the ubiquitin-activating enzyme E1 in HepG2 cells. 下载免费PDF全文
A L Schwartz J S Trausch A Ciechanover J W Slot H Geuze 《Proceedings of the National Academy of Sciences of the United States of America》1992,89(12):5542-5546
As the first enzyme in the ubiquitin system the ubiquitin-activating enzyme E1 plays a pivotal role in all pathways of protein ubiquitination. In an effort to learn more about the cell biology of this pathway, we have purified the 110-kDa enzyme to homogeneity and generated a panel of distinct monoclonal antibodies to it. Using quantitative electron microscopic immunolocalization with these anti-E1 monoclonal antibodies, we find that E1 is abundant both within the cytoplasm and nucleus. Within the cytoplasm, E1 was found throughout the cytoplasmic volume as well as enriched along the cytoplasmic face of the rough endoplasmic reticulum and associated with the dense material along the desmosomal junctions. E1 was also found associated with the cytoplasmic surface of endosomal/lysosomal vacuoles. Interestingly, E1 was also found within the mitochondria. The lumen of rough endoplasmic reticulum, Golgi complex, endosomes, and lysosomes were negative. The specific localization of E1 to distinct subcellular organelles suggests that E1 may play multiple physiological roles within the cell. 相似文献
